A device’s IP address actually consists of two separate parts: Network ID: The network ID is a part of the IP address starting from the left that identifies the specific network on which the device is located. On a typical home network, where a device has the IP address 192.168.1.34, the 192.168.1 part of the address will be the network ID. 7 Free Services to Trace a Location From an IP Address InfoSniper.
